In the first part, where the train is struggling up a big hill, each verse (part of the poem) is just two lines long. Pairs of lines like this are called couplets and when they rhyme, as they do in this poem, they are called rhyming couplets.

WebbFind rhymes for any word or phrase with our powerful rhyming dictionary and rhyme generator. WebbA strong rhythm gives the language energy. Rhythm also makes the words easier for actors to memorise. Rhythm and rhyme is used to distinguish between certain types of characters. Noble characters usually speak in blank verse, whereas everyday common folk speak just like we do. Characters that are strange and magical often speak in rhyme.
